Метод rename на модула os
Методът rename преименува и/или
премества файл или папка. В първия параметър
на метода задаваме началния път до файла или
папката, във втория параметър - новия път
или име на файла/папката. Във втория и третия
незадължителни параметри можем да посочим
файлов дескриптор на началния и крайния
път съответно. Методът връща None.
Ако файлът, който искаме да преименуваме,
не съществува, тогава методът връща изключение
FileNotFoundError.
Синтаксис
import os
os.rename(начален път, нов път, [файлов дескриптор на началния път], [файлов дескриптор на новия път])
Пример
Нека преименуваме папка dir1:
import os
os.rename('dir1', 'dir2')
Пример
Сега нека преименуваме файл:
import os
os.rename('file1.txt', 'file2.txt')
Вижте също
-
метод
makedirsна модулos,
който създава директория -
метод
removeна модулos,
който изтрива файл -
метод
getcwdна модулos,
който връща текущата работна папка -
метод
listdirна модулos,
който връща списък с файлове в работната папка -
метод
path.isdirна модулos,
който проверява съществуването на папка -
метод
path.isfileна модулos,
който проверява съществуването на файл